CBS has released an official description for the Monday, February 29 episode of Supergirl, titled “Solitude,” and with it they’ve released their first look at the Fortress of Solitude on this series!

Oh yeah, and this is also when Laura Vandervoort (Smallville’s Supergirl) makes her first appearance as Indigo. Here’s the description:

Kara travels to Superman’s Fortress of Solitude in hopes of learning how to defeat Indigo (Laura Vandervoort), a dangerous being who can transport via the Internet and who has a connection to Kara’s past. Also, James’s relationship with Lucy reaches a crossroads, on SUPERGIRL, Monday, Feb. 29 (8:00-9:00 PM, ET/PT) on the CBS Television Network.

Supergirl stars Melissa Benoist (Kara Danvers/Supergirl), Calista Flockhart (Cat Grant), Chyler Leigh (Alex Danvers), Mehcad Brooks (James Olsen), David Harewood (Hank Henshaw), and Jeremy Jordan (Winslow “Winn” Schott).

Recurring guests appearing in “Solitude” include Jenna Dewan-Tatum (Lucy Lane), Chris Vance (Non), Italia Ricci (Siobhan Smythe), Briana Venskus (Agent Vasquez), and Jay Jackson (News Anchor).

Additional guest stars include Laura Vandervoort (Indigo), Patrick O’Connell (General Mathers), Kelly Chavers (Girlfriend), Ruben Vernier (Boyfriend), Sebastian Velmont (Silo Guard #1), Nick Jaine (Guy #1), Carly Nykanen (Woman), and Michael Hanson (Guy#2).

The “Solitude” story is by Rachel Shukert and the eleplay is by Anna Musky-Goldwyn and James DeWille. The episode is directed by Dermott Downs.

Photo: The Daily Planet Returns in Superman & Lois Season 4

Tyler Hoechlin has shared a photo showing the return of the Daily Planet for Superman & Lois Season 4.

Published

on

Adding to the recent news about the casting of Douglas Smith as Jimmy Olsen, Tyler Hoechlin today shared a photo on Instagram showing off Clark Kent and Lois Lane inside the Daily Planet. This fuels our suspicion that another flashback story may be on the way for Superman & Lois Season 4!

“Back to work at the Daily Planet with @bitsietulloch. Hard to believe we only have five weeks left,” Tyler shared, simultaneously confirming that indeed, there are only five weeks of filming left for The CW TV show.

The fourth and final season of Superman & Lois is headed our way Fall 2024 on The CW. You can take a look at Tyler’s post below.
